Default confused using 11R mic input with Logic 9

Hi everybody.

Yesterday I tried to record some vocals via 11R mic input into Logic.
To bad I didn't succeed.

Recording the mic input in Protools does work.
(In Pro Tools I can simply select "mic" for input)

In Logic I can see the inputs of 11R (1->8)
And recording guitar is no problem. (input 1 for unprocessed sounds, input 3 for moddeled sounds)

I tested all other outputs to get the mic input but no signal.

I also tried putting the input selection on 11R to "mic"
But then the mic signal gets moddeled in 11R. (and I don't want that)

Basically I would like to record vocals straight to Logic.
Using 11R as a digital interface.
And at the same time record guitars (modelled via 11R) to Logic.

Anybody have an idea what I do wrong?

Thanks for your help.

Jesse

Default Re: confused using 11R mic input with Logic 9

I don't know what your problem can be. I also use Logic 9 and it works just fine:
Input 1: DI Guitar Track
Input 2: Microphone
Input 3: Guitar Modeled L
Input 4: Guitar Modeled R
(the rest I don't know by heart).

I do however have a problem sometimes and that is when I have the vocal track record enabled and then just start playing back the song. From that moment on I'm not able to hear the vocals anymore. But, if I have the vocal track record enabled AND also start recording I can hear the vocals just fine.

It is possible to record: Your DI guitar track, your vocals and you modeled guitar track at the same time. I do it all the time in Logic :)

Default Re: confused using 11R mic input with Logic 9

Quote:
Originally Posted by jezzbo View Post
I tested all other outputs to get the mic input but no signal.
I use a mic with Logic 9 and the 11R with no problem.
The unprocessed mic signal comes out of input 2 in Logic. Be sure to check the mic gain control on the 11R front panel. The signal can be quite low when the signal is not going through the rig. Also make sure the phantom power is on if you are using a condenser mic. If you select the mic as the rig input on the 11R, then the processed signal will come from input 3 and 4 in Logic.
